Dartmouth Endowment Invests $3.3M in Solana ETF Amid Crypto Shift

Dartmouth College’s endowment has invested $3.3 million in a Solana ETF, signaling growing institutional confidence in the cryptocurrency market amidst changing investment trends.

In a move that signals a significant shift in the investment landscape, Dartmouth College’s endowment has allocated $3.3 million to a Solana ETF. This decision could not only bolster the profile of Solana crypto but also indicate growing institutional confidence in the cryptocurrency market.

What Does This Mean for Solana and the Broader Crypto Market?

The infusion of funds into a Solana ETF could be a boon for the Solana ecosystem itself. More investment typically translates into increased development, innovation, and use-case scenarios, which can lead to higher adoption rates among both developers and users.

This is particularly crucial as Solana has been positioning itself as a scalable solution within the crypto space. With its technological prowess, Solana could attract further institutional interest, reinforcing the idea that these digital assets are becoming a mature investment class.
